Why do we need this?
We get many enquiries that never work out for several reasons which I list below in no special order:
- People don’t know where to go or what options they have
- Price nearly always exceeds budget when the extras are added in
- The usual hotel and travel search engines, only provide accommodation and travel costs missing out on extras such as experiences, entrance and park fees, taxes, specialised transport (4×4 safari vehicle with or without guide), air charters, scheduled flights with unlisted carries, – the list is long!
- They shop around and contact too many competing agents frustrating them all and lose their trust in the process
- They book too late or expect to stay in places that are already fully booked
- They have a hard time accepting advice
Our aim is to eliminate most of these by pointing you towards suitable destinations, best time to visit these, ideas of experiences you can include and best of all, a close estimate of the cost you can expect – before we spend too much time heading down the wrong path.
